The 10 cent piece minted in 1920 at the San Francisco mint represents a classic era of United States coinage. Struck in 90 percent silver, this Mercury Dime contains 0.0715 troy ounces of precious metal. This specific coin survives in Good to Very Good condition, showing the honest wear of a piece that circulated widely during the early twentieth century. Designed by Adolph Weinman, the obverse of the coin displays a youthful representation of Liberty. She wears a winged Phrygian cap, a powerful symbol that historically led the public to mistake her for the Roman messenger god, Mercury, giving the series its famous nickname. On the reverse, the design presents a fasces alongside an olive branch, contrasting symbols of strength and peace.
